起步软件技术论坛
搜索
 找回密码
 注册

QQ登录

只需一步,快速开始

查看: 10553|回复: 21

[结贴] BEX5 3.6 ,我想在pc3界面上增加一个想代办任务一样的图标?

[复制链接]
发表于 2017-7-14 17:04:04 | 显示全部楼层 |阅读模式
图标是增加了,但是点击却没反应,这里是怎么控制的?

91

主题

13万

帖子

3万

积分

管理员

Rank: 9Rank: 9Rank: 9

积分
36069
发表于 2017-7-14 17:28:57 | 显示全部楼层
如果是指显示的待办任务数量的图标,平台的js中是通过x-portal-task-wait样式设置变量,然后进行控制的
可以看/UI2/portal/base/base.js中的处理
  1. var selectors = {
  2.                 pages : '.x-portal-pages',
  3.                 username : '.x-portal-username',
  4.                 agent : '.x-portal-agent',
  5.                 reload : '.x-portal-reload',
  6.                 waitTask : '.x-portal-task-wait',
  7.                 logout : '.x-portal-logout',
  8.                 setPassWord : '.x-portal-setPassWord',
  9.                 showMainPage: '.x-portal-showMain',
  10.                 datetime: '.x-portal-datetime'
  11.         };
复制代码
远程的联系方法QQ1392416607,添加好友时,需在备注里注明其论坛名字及ID,公司等信息
发远程时同时也发一下帖子地址,方便了解要解决的问题  WeX5教程  WeX5下载



如按照该方法解决,请及时跟帖,便于版主结贴
回复 支持 反对

使用道具 举报

 楼主| 发表于 2017-7-15 11:18:26 | 显示全部楼层
jishuang 发表于 2017-7-14 17:28
如果是指显示的待办任务数量的图标,平台的js中是通过x-portal-task-wait样式设置变量,然后进行控制的
可 ...

我说的是打开代办任务页面的这个动作是怎么触发的
回复 支持 反对

使用道具 举报

91

主题

13万

帖子

3万

积分

管理员

Rank: 9Rank: 9Rank: 9

积分
36069
发表于 2017-7-17 09:34:46 | 显示全部楼层
首页的图标待办任务相关的就只有显示待办任务数量 的,没有其他的图标

如果是widget中的打开具体的任务页,那是待办任务页面在list的li上bind-click中实现的
远程的联系方法QQ1392416607,添加好友时,需在备注里注明其论坛名字及ID,公司等信息
发远程时同时也发一下帖子地址,方便了解要解决的问题  WeX5教程  WeX5下载



如按照该方法解决,请及时跟帖,便于版主结贴
回复 支持 反对

使用道具 举报

 楼主| 发表于 2017-7-17 09:55:26 | 显示全部楼层
jishuang 发表于 2017-7-17 09:34
首页的图标待办任务相关的就只有显示待办任务数量 的,没有其他的图标

如果是widget中的打开具体的任务页 ...

右上角有个小旗子,点小旗子会打开任务中心,这个是这么处理的?
回复 支持 反对

使用道具 举报

91

主题

13万

帖子

3万

积分

管理员

Rank: 9Rank: 9Rank: 9

积分
36069
发表于 2017-7-17 10:34:56 | 显示全部楼层
那就是我2楼发的啊,在代码中找对
waitTask : '.x-portal-task-wait',中的waitTask的click事件的处理啊
远程的联系方法QQ1392416607,添加好友时,需在备注里注明其论坛名字及ID,公司等信息
发远程时同时也发一下帖子地址,方便了解要解决的问题  WeX5教程  WeX5下载



如按照该方法解决,请及时跟帖,便于版主结贴
回复 支持 反对

使用道具 举报

 楼主| 发表于 2017-7-18 10:23:25 | 显示全部楼层
jishuang 发表于 2017-7-17 10:34
那就是我2楼发的啊,在代码中找对
waitTask : '.x-portal-task-wait',中的waitTask的click事件的处理啊
...

return this.shellImpl.showPage(options);这句话什么意思,这么打开页面的?
回复 支持 反对

使用道具 举报

 楼主| 发表于 2017-7-18 10:30:06 | 显示全部楼层
jishuang 发表于 2017-7-17 10:34
那就是我2楼发的啊,在代码中找对
waitTask : '.x-portal-task-wait',中的waitTask的click事件的处理啊
...

我的目的是想做单点登录,调用第三方API,登录第三方系统
回复 支持 反对

使用道具 举报

91

主题

13万

帖子

3万

积分

管理员

Rank: 9Rank: 9Rank: 9

积分
36069
发表于 2017-7-18 11:44:17 | 显示全部楼层
showPage就是打开功能页面


调用第三方是需要第三方提供API的,可以直接在bind-click事件中去实现
远程的联系方法QQ1392416607,添加好友时,需在备注里注明其论坛名字及ID,公司等信息
发远程时同时也发一下帖子地址,方便了解要解决的问题  WeX5教程  WeX5下载



如按照该方法解决,请及时跟帖,便于版主结贴
回复 支持 反对

使用道具 举报

 楼主| 发表于 2017-7-18 12:22:55 | 显示全部楼层
jishuang 发表于 2017-7-18 11:44
showPage就是打开功能页面

我不明白的是this.shellImpl.showPage("waitTask");就能打开任务中心
我把waitTask换成其他,同时,也在_cfg里定义了一个跟waitTask一样的代码,只是把waitTask换成其他名字,就报错了?
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

小黑屋|手机版|X3技术论坛|Justep Inc.    

GMT+8, 2024-11-26 14:24 , Processed in 0.057164 second(s), 24 queries .

Powered by Discuz! X3.4

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表